cdd.dll Download

  • Download cdd.dll
  • Size: 124.02 KB

Download Button

Understanding cdd.dll: What It Is and Why It Matters

The cdd.dll file is a critical component of the Windows operating system, specifically designed to facilitate graphics rendering and display management. This Dynamic Link Library (DLL) plays a vital role in ensuring that graphical user interfaces (GUIs) operate smoothly, enabling applications to communicate effectively with your system’s hardware. Without a functioning cdd.dll, users may encounter display errors, slow performance, or application crashes, particularly when handling graphics-intensive tasks.

The Role of cdd.dll in Modern Computing

In modern computing environments, cdd.dll is primarily associated with the Windows Graphics Device Interface (GDI). GDI handles the rendering of fonts, lines, and shapes in applications. When applications request graphical processing, cdd.dll acts as a mediator, translating those requests into instructions your GPU or CPU can understand. Its seamless operation ensures that visuals are rendered quickly and accurately, contributing to an optimal user experience across both legacy and modern applications.

Common Issues Linked to cdd.dll

Despite its importance, cdd.dll can sometimes become corrupted or missing due to system errors, malware attacks, or failed software installations. Common symptoms of issues with this DLL include:

  • Unexpected program crashes when opening applications or games.
  • Screen flickering or graphical glitches in certain programs.
  • Error messages stating that “cdd.dll is missing” or “cdd.dll not found.”
  • Slow system performance during graphic-intensive tasks.

Identifying these issues early is crucial to prevent further system instability or potential hardware stress.

Safe Methods to Restore cdd.dll

Restoring cdd.dll should be approached with caution, as downloading DLL files from unofficial sources can compromise system security. Recommended steps include:

1. Using System File Checker (SFC)

Windows includes a built-in utility called System File Checker that scans and repairs missing or corrupted system files. To use SFC:

  1. Open Command Prompt as an administrator.
  2. Type sfc /scannow and press Enter.
  3. Wait for the process to complete, which may automatically restore cdd.dll.

2. Performing Windows Update

Sometimes, missing DLL issues can be resolved through system updates, as Microsoft periodically releases patches that fix file inconsistencies. Navigate to Settings > Update & Security > Windows Update and check for updates to ensure your system has the latest fixes.

3. Reinstalling Affected Applications

If the cdd.dll error occurs with a specific program, reinstalling the software may replace corrupted DLL references and restore functionality. Ensure you download the installation files from official sources.

Advanced Troubleshooting Techniques

Using DISM Tool

The Deployment Imaging Service and Management Tool (DISM) is another powerful utility to repair damaged Windows images, which can indirectly fix cdd.dll issues. To use DISM:

  1. Open Command Prompt with administrative privileges.
  2. Enter DISM /Online /Cleanup-Image /RestoreHealth and press Enter.
  3. Allow the process to complete, which can take several minutes.

Checking for Malware

Malware infections can target DLL files, including cdd.dll, causing errors and system instability. Running a full system scan with trusted antivirus software is essential to detect and eliminate malicious programs that may corrupt DLLs.

Preventive Measures to Avoid cdd.dll Errors

Maintaining a healthy system is the best way to prevent future cdd.dll problems. Here are essential practices:

  • Regularly update Windows and installed applications.
  • Keep antivirus software active and perform scheduled scans.
  • Avoid downloading DLL files from unverified sources online.
  • Back up system files and create restore points before installing new software.

Understanding cdd.dll Dependencies

The cdd.dll file is interlinked with other Windows components such as DirectX, graphics drivers, and the Windows kernel. Keeping these dependencies updated is crucial for system stability. Outdated graphics drivers, for example, can conflict with cdd.dll, causing rendering errors or application crashes.

Conclusion: The Importance of Maintaining cdd.dll Integrity

The cdd.dll file may be small in size, but its role in system graphics management is significant. Ensuring its proper functionality is vital for smooth application performance, stable display rendering, and an overall efficient Windows experience. By following safe restoration methods, performing routine system maintenance, and staying vigilant against malware, users can prevent most cdd.dll-related issues and maintain a reliable computing environment.

Final Tips

Always prioritize official tools and updates over third-party DLL downloads. Regular backups, proper software installation practices, and up-to-date drivers will minimize the risk of encountering cdd.dll errors, allowing your system to perform at its best with minimal interruptions.